The Right Way to Use Power Planes in a 4-Layer PCB Stackup
8 min
Blog
PCB Design Engineers
Many products are manufactured on four-layer PCBs, and these are something of an entry-level stackup for many designs. From a signal integrity and EMI/EMC standpoint, the easiest four-layer stack to use is the Sig/GND/GND/Sig stackup, as it enables high-speed digital routing with controlled impedances on both sides of the board, but without a requirement for coplanar ground on the surface layers. Although this is the best stackup from a signal...

In high-speed printed circuit board (PCB) design, ensuring signal integrity is crucial to achieve reliable and efficient performance. Signal integrity refers to the preservation of the quality of electrical signals as they travel through the PCB, free from distortion and noise. Several factors influence signal integrity, including via design, ground plane strategies, and design for manufacturability (DFM). This article explores these critical...
